
U.S. Army
Dore, George H.
ConflictCivil War
Year of Action1863
Unit/CommandCompany D, 126th New York Infantry
Citation
The colors being struck down by a shell as the enemy were charging, this soldier rushed out and seized it, exposing himself to the fire of both sides.
